Notlar Ms. codex.Title from fol. 1b.Physical description: 17 lines per page; written in neat naskh in black on glazed, laid European paper. Text and columns framed in red. Crude silver illumination on fol. 1b-2a; ʻunwān has been cut away and replaced with plain paper. Rubrication and catchwords. Occasional damp staining and smudging; in good condition.Incipit: بسمليله ايده لم فتح كلام * فتح اولا تا بو معماى بنام - Three-quarter leather with marbled paper covers. - A poem in praise of the Prophet Muhammad, describing his personal appearance and character. The poem was composed in 1007 H [1598 or 1599] as stated in the last line (fol. 24a). Text is followed by charts showing the distances of 97 cities from Istanbul on fol. 24b-29b.
